Through manual manipulation of the spine delivered to the highest standards by licensed chiropractors, chiropractic care works to restore and maintain proper communication from your brain to your body by relieving what chiropractors refer to as a subluxation, or a misalignment, of the spine. Dr. Sophia Chang joined The Joint Chiropractic’s network of doctors in 2021, when she became the local chiropractor in Los Angeles, California. She is a graduate from Cleveland Chiropractic College and is excited to relive the local community of all aches and pains.
Dr. Chang knew that chiropractic care was her calling after an injury playing volleyball in school. Nothing was able to relieve her pain until she met her chiropractor who was able to get her back on the court.
Dr. Chang says that the best thing about working in the chiropractic field is her patients. She loves being able to help others find the relief she also found from routine chiropractic care.
Over the course of her career, Dr. Chang has learned to serve a range of patients from infants to athletes, with a range of cases, including migraines, neck pain, upper and lower back pain, sciatica, arthritis and more.

In a recent Consumer Reports study, chiropractic outperformed prescription medication, deep-tissue massage, yoga, pilates, and over-the-counter medication therapies, in treating back pain. 1
1 Consumer Reports Health Ratings Center. Back-Pain Treatments. ConsumerReports.org; July 2011.
